金华住房与城乡建设部网站企业网站维护建设项目实践报告

张小明 2026/1/17 15:34:37
金华住房与城乡建设部网站,企业网站维护建设项目实践报告,全网营销推广系统,网站中文名使用树状图可视化层级数据#xff0c;可以使复杂的信息一目了然。本文将介绍如何使用 C# 和Aspose.Cells for .NET在 Excel 中创建树状图。本指南包含完整的可运行代码示例、自定义图表外观的技巧以及快速入门的资源。 Aspose.Cells官方试用版免费下载 用于创建树状图的 C# …使用树状图可视化层级数据可以使复杂的信息一目了然。本文将介绍如何使用 C# 和Aspose.Cells for .NET在 Excel 中创建树状图。本指南包含完整的可运行代码示例、自定义图表外观的技巧以及快速入门的资源。Aspose.Cells官方试用版免费下载用于创建树状图的 C# Excel 库Aspose.Cells for .NET是一个功能全面的 Excel 操作库允许开发人员在不使用 Microsoft Office 的情况下创建、编辑和渲染 Excel 文件。它支持多种图表类型包括树状图该图表非常适合可视化层级结构例如按地区、产品类别或组织结构图划分的销售额。使用Aspose.Cells for .NET的主要优势丰富的 API– 完全访问工作簿、工作表、单元格和图表对象。高性能——能够高效处理大型工作簿和数据集。无外部依赖项– 可在任何支持 .NET 的平台上运行。多种导出格式– 保存为 XLSX、XLS、CSV、PDF、PNG 等格式。入门很简单从慧都网Aspose.Cells 页面下载库。安装 NuGet 包PM Install-Package Aspose.Cells使用 C# 在 Excel 中创建树状图如何构建树状图以下示例演示了如何操作创建一个新的工作簿。在工作表中填充层级数据。添加树状图。配置剧集、标题和格式。将工作簿保存为 Excel 文件。注意——该代码是完全独立的可以使用 .NET 6.0 或更高版本进行编译。// ------------------------------ // 1. Create a new workbook // ------------------------------ var workbook new Workbook(); var sheet workbook.Worksheets[0]; sheet.Name SalesData; // ------------------------------------------------- // 2. Fill the worksheet with hierarchical sample data // ------------------------------------------------- // A B C D E // ------------------------------------------------- // Region Country Category Subcategory Sales // Europe Germany Electronics Phones 120000 // Europe Germany Electronics Laptops 85000 // Europe France Furniture Chairs 45000 // Asia China Electronics Phones 200000 // Asia China Furniture Tables 95000 // America USA Electronics TVs 175000 // ------------------------------------------------- string[,] data new string[,] { { Region, Country, Category, Subcategory, Sales }, { Europe, Germany, Electronics, Phones, 120000 }, { Europe, Germany, Electronics, Laptops, 85000 }, { Europe, France, Furniture, Chairs, 45000 }, { Asia, China, Electronics, Phones, 200000 }, { Asia, China, Furniture, Tables, 95000 }, { America, USA, Electronics, TVs, 175000 } }; for (int row 0; row data.GetLength(0); row) { for (int col 0; col data.GetLength(1); col) { sheet.Cells[row, col].PutValue(data[row, col]); } } // ------------------------------------------------- // 3. Add a Treemap chart // ------------------------------------------------- // The chart will be placed starting at row 9, column 0 // and will occupy rows 9?30 and columns 0?10. int chartIndex sheet.Charts.Add(ChartType.Treemap, 9, 0, 30, 10); Chart treemap sheet.Charts[chartIndex]; // Set chart title treemap.Title.Text Global Sales Treemap; // ------------------------------------------------- // 4. Define the series for the Treemap // ------------------------------------------------- // The data range includes columns A?E (rows 2?7) without the header. // Category data (hierarchy) is taken from columns A?D. // Values are taken from column E. treemap.NSeries.Add(SalesData!$E$2:$E$7, true); treemap.NSeries.CategoryData SalesData!$A$2:$D$7; // ------------------------------------------------- // 5. Customize the appearance (optional) // ------------------------------------------------- // Example: set a graduated fill based on sales values. treemap.NSeries[0].IsColorVaried true; // Vary color by value // ------------------------------------------------- // 6. Save the workbook // ------------------------------------------------- string outputPath TreemapChart_Output.xlsx; workbook.Save(outputPath); Console.WriteLine($Treemap chart created successfully. File saved to: {outputPath});关键步骤说明步目的1实例化一个新的对象Workbook并获取第一个工作表。2将分层销售数据填充到工作表中。第一行包含标题。3添加一个图表类型ChartType.Treemap。图表的位置和大小由传递给的行/列索引定义Charts.Add。4添加一个使用销售额作为值范围E2:E7和层次结构A2:D7作为类别数据的单个系列。5启用数据标签使其同时显示数值和类别名称并根据销售额激活颜色变化。6将工作簿保存为 XLSX 文件。生成的文件可在 Excel 中打开以查看树状图。结论使用 Aspose.Cells for .NET 创建树状图非常简单只需几行代码即可完成。该库无需 Microsoft Office 即可处理数据层次结构、图表渲染和文件输出。按照上面的示例您可以快速生成专业的树状图可视化图表用于财务报告、销售分析或任何层次结构数据集。
版权声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!

餐饮网站建设规划书做图神器的网站

终极指南:3步快速完成Qwen3-VL模型在Windows环境的ComfyUI本地部署 【免费下载链接】Qwen3-VL-4B-Instruct-unsloth-bnb-4bit 项目地址: https://ai.gitcode.com/hf_mirrors/unsloth/Qwen3-VL-4B-Instruct-unsloth-bnb-4bit 想要在个人电脑上搭建强大的多模…

张小明 2025/12/27 3:11:24 网站建设

中山制作网站的公司网站代码字体变大

还在为Google Play设备验证失败而困扰吗?PlayIntegrityFix作为2025年最有效的设备认证修复工具,能够快速解决Play Integrity验证问题,让你的设备重新获得完整认证。本指南将帮助你从零开始完成安装配置,彻底摆脱认证失败的烦恼。 …

张小明 2025/12/27 3:11:20 网站建设

实训课建设网站步骤嘉兴建设教育网站培训中心网站

1. MQTT 是什么类型的协议? A. 请求-响应协议 B. 发布-订阅协议 C. 点对点协议 D. 广播协议 答案:B 解析: MQTT(Message Queuing Telemetry Transport)是基于发布-订阅模式的轻量级消息传输协议。 2. MQTT 主要设计用于哪种场景? A. 高带宽网络环境 B. 低带宽、高延迟…

张小明 2026/1/16 8:36:14 网站建设

网站制作的要求广州知名设计公司排名

Linly-Talker 对网络带宽的要求及离线使用可能性 在虚拟主播、智能客服和数字员工日益普及的今天,一个关键问题逐渐浮现:这些依赖AI驱动的数字人系统,是否必须时刻“在线”?尤其是在工厂内网、偏远地区或对数据安全要求极高的场景…

张小明 2026/1/16 0:51:03 网站建设

网站安全防护搜索网站的方法

YOLOv10 iOS部署终极指南:5大关键技术实现3倍性能提升 【免费下载链接】ultralytics ultralytics - 提供 YOLOv8 模型,用于目标检测、图像分割、姿态估计和图像分类,适合机器学习和计算机视觉领域的开发者。 项目地址: https://gitcode.com…

张小明 2026/1/7 23:26:42 网站建设

一个新的网站怎么做SEO优化省交通建设质安监督局网站

Linux使用技巧与优质信息资源汇总 一、多屏幕分辨率设置 如果你想在图形用户界面(GUI)中切换不同的屏幕分辨率,例如在使用1024 x 768分辨率的同时,还想查看网页在800 x 600甚至640 x 480分辨率下的显示效果,可以通过以下步骤在Linux系统中进行设置: 1. 定位配置文件 …

张小明 2026/1/6 0:01:56 网站建设